A slope-unstable bundle on a surface with 1-homogeneous projectivization

Jihao Liu

Abstract

We answer affirmatively a question of Fulger and Langer on the interplay between slope semistability and positivity for projective bundles with vanishing discriminant. The main result of this paper was obtained by Chatgpt 5.5 pro, and the Danus system based on the Rethlas system.
